Streaming Telegram Agent
OpenAI agent with token-by-token streaming via live message edits
Part of the Telegram interface examples. Follow the setup guide.
Code
from agno.agent import Agent
from agno.db.sqlite import SqliteDb
from agno.models.openai import OpenAIChat
from agno.os.app import AgentOS
from agno.os.interfaces.telegram import Telegram
agent_db = SqliteDb(
session_table="telegram_sessions", db_file="tmp/telegram_streaming.db"
)
telegram_agent = Agent(
name="Telegram Streaming Bot",
model=OpenAIChat(id="gpt-4o-mini"),
db=agent_db,
instructions=[
"You are a helpful assistant on Telegram.",
"Keep responses concise and friendly.",
"In groups, respond when mentioned with @ or when someone replies to your message.",
],
add_history_to_context=True,
num_history_runs=3,
add_datetime_to_context=True,
markdown=True,
)
agent_os = AgentOS(
agents=[telegram_agent],
interfaces=[
Telegram(
agent=telegram_agent,
reply_to_mentions_only=True,
streaming=True,
)
],
)
app = agent_os.get_app()
if __name__ == "__main__":
agent_os.serve(app="streaming:app", reload=True)Usage

Use this secret as secret_token when registering the public webhook in the setup guide. Keep the same value in the server and registration terminals. APP_ENV=development bypasses webhook authentication, so clear it for this public callback flow.
export TELEGRAM_TOKEN=your-bot-token-from-botfather
export OPENAI_API_KEY=your-openai-api-key
export TELEGRAM_WEBHOOK_SECRET_TOKEN=replace-with-a-long-random-secret
unset APP_ENVInstall dependencies

Key Features
- Token-by-Token Streaming: Responses appear incrementally as they are generated
- Live Message Edits: The bot edits its message in real time, throttled to stay within Telegram rate limits
- Conversation History: Maintains context with last 3 interactions
- Persistent Memory: SQLite database for session storage
